What is DHL eCommerce USPS?

DHL eCommerce provides standard domestic and international carrier services, as well as return solutions and eCommerce logistics tools. They specialize in high-volume shipping, partnering with different carriers to handle last-mile delivery (in the US, the USPS handles DHL eCommerce’s last-mile delivery).

Does DHL eCommerce use USPS?

DHL partners with local postal services to offer domestic shipping services. In the US, USPS handles the final mile and return pickups, while DHL manages the initial pickup and sorting of the packages.

Who delivers DHL packages in USA?

Since 2003, the Postal Service has provided last-mile delivery for DHL in over 20,000 ZIP Codes nationwide through its Parcel Select service. This expansion makes USPS the exclusive provider of delivery service to DHL for 3,600 of the nation’s 46,000 ZIP Codes through use of Priority Mail and Parcel Select service.

Whats the difference between DHL and DHL eCommerce?

DHL Express and DHL eCommerce are two separate companies owned by the same parent: Deutsche Post DHL Group. DHL Express exclusively provides international services, while DHL eCommerce offers both domestic and international services.
